What Is a Contrast Collar Color and Why Is It Important?
A contrast collar color refers to a collar that features a color that is distinct or different from the main fabric of a garment, typically shirts. This design element serves both aesthetic and functional purposes, impacting overall style and communication of the wearer.
Importance of Contrast Collar Colors:
-
Style Statement: A well-chosen contrast collar can elevate an outfit by adding depth and visual interest. For instance, a white shirt with a navy blue collar creates a classic yet modern look suitable for both casual and formal settings.
-
Highlighting Features: Contrast collars can draw attention to the face, enhancing personal features. For example, a collar in a bright color can brighten up the overall look, making the wearer appear more vibrant.
-
Professional Appeal: In workplaces, a contrast collar can convey authority and professionalism. A tailored white dress shirt with a dark blue collar is often seen in corporate environments, making a powerful impression during meetings.
-
Personal Expression: Different colors can reflect individual style and personality. A bold red collar can showcase confidence, while softer pastel shades might convey a more approachable vibe.
Selecting the right contrast collar color can significantly influence both personal style and the impression made on others.

What Contrast Collar Colors Complement Dark Shirts Best?
- White: A classic choice, white collars stand out sharply against dark shirts, creating a crisp and clean aesthetic. This combination is timeless and works well in both formal and casual settings.
- Light Blue: Light blue collars offer a softer contrast while still maintaining visibility against dark shirts. This color adds a hint of color without being overly bold, making it perfect for business or smart-casual attire.
- Gray: A medium to light gray collar provides a subtle yet elegant contrast that is less stark than white. It pairs well with various dark shades, making it versatile for different styles and occasions.
- Pastel Colors: Colors like pale pink, mint green, or lavender can provide a trendy and modern contrast to dark shirts. These pastel shades add a fresh and youthful vibe, making them suitable for more creative or relaxed environments.
- Beige or Khaki: These neutral tones work surprisingly well with dark shirts, offering a warm contrast that is sophisticated yet understated. They are ideal for achieving a more casual look while still appearing polished.
- Black: A black collar on a dark shirt can create a monochromatic look that is sleek and modern. This pairing is particularly effective when different textures or fabrics are used to differentiate the collar from the shirt.
Which Contrast Collar Colors Are Ideal for Light Shirts?
- White: A classic choice that creates a clean and sophisticated look, white contrast collars work well with almost any light-colored shirt. This combination highlights the collar while maintaining a timeless elegance, making it suitable for both casual and formal occasions.
- Light Blue: Light blue collars add a subtle touch of color without overwhelming the shirt’s overall appearance. This pairing is particularly effective for creating a relaxed yet polished look, ideal for business casual settings or weekend outings.
- Pale Pink: A pale pink contrast collar introduces a warm, soft hue that can brighten up a light shirt. This color is great for adding a hint of personality while remaining sophisticated, making it a popular choice for spring and summer wear.
- Lavender: Lavender is a unique and trendy option that pairs beautifully with light shirts, offering a refreshing twist. This color adds a bit of playfulness and is a great way to stand out subtly, suitable for both daytime and evening events.
- Gray: A light gray contrast collar provides a modern and understated look that works exceptionally well with light shirts. This neutral option complements various colors and patterns, making it versatile for various styles and occasions.
- Beige or Cream: These warm neutral tones create a soft and harmonious appearance when paired with light shirts. They are ideal for achieving a refined and elegant look, especially in more formal settings or during the warmer months.
- Black: A black contrast collar offers a bold and striking appearance against light shirts, creating a strong visual contrast. This option is particularly suited for evening wear or more formal occasions, lending an air of authority and sophistication.

What Essential Style Tips Should I Follow for Contrast Collar Colors?
When selecting contrast collar colors, consider the following essential style tips:
- Choose Complementary Colors: Opt for colors that complement each other to create a cohesive look. For instance, pairing a light blue shirt with a navy collar can add sophistication while maintaining harmony.
- Consider Your Skin Tone: Your skin tone plays a crucial role in how colors appear on you. Warm skin tones generally look better in earthy tones like browns and greens, while cool skin tones are enhanced by blues and purples.
- Keep the Occasion in Mind: Different settings call for different styles. For formal events, more subdued and classic contrast colors like white or dark shades work well, while casual settings allow for bolder, brighter choices.
- Balance Patterns and Textures: If your shirt has a pattern, ensure the collar color contrasts but doesn’t clash. A simple striped shirt with a solid colored collar can create a striking yet balanced look.
- Match with Accessories: Coordinate your contrast collar with other accessories, such as ties or pocket squares. This creates a unified appearance and can enhance the overall aesthetic of your outfit.
- Test with Neutrals: If unsure about bold colors, start with neutral base colors for your shirt and experiment with various collar colors. Neutrals are versatile and provide a great backdrop for brighter contrasts, allowing you to play with color without overwhelming your outfit.
